Autism Misconceptions And Facts
Autism is a developing condition with signs and symptoms that appear within the initial three years of life. The word "spectrum" shows that autism shows up in different forms with differing degrees of intensity. That implies that each individual with autism experiences their very own distinct toughness, signs and symptoms, and difficulties. A wide range of treatments, from early childhood years and across the life expectancy, can maximize the advancement, health, well-being and lifestyle of autistic people.
According to the Centers for Condition Control, autism impacts an estimated 1 in 36 kids and 1 in 45 adults in the USA today. Autism spectrum disorder is a neurological and developing condition that influences exactly how people connect with others, interact, find out, and act. Although autism can be diagnosed at any kind of age, it is referred to as a "developing problem" due to the fact that symptoms usually appear in the very first two years of life. Comprehensive research utilizing a selection of different methods and carried out over years has demonstrated that the measles, mumps and rubella vaccination does not create autism. Research studies that were taken indicating any such link were flawed, and some of the writers had undeclared biases that influenced what they reported about their research (2,3,4).
